About The Position

This role oversees all aspects of facilities management, including maintenance, custodial services, and repairs. The Facilities Manager is responsible for maintaining accurate records, coordinating with the corporate office on repairs and information updates, and reviewing contractual agreements and warranties. The position also involves managing building repair and maintenance activities, conducting regular inspections for needed repairs, and ensuring cleaning company meets contractual obligations. Additionally, the role ensures operational readiness of copier equipment, manages audio/visual needs, maintains phones and radios, and coordinates end-of-year locker cleanup and maintenance. The Facilities Manager also arranges transportation for school trips, schedules fire drills, assists with campus control and security, and maintains HVAC, key, and alarm systems. Responsibilities extend to confirming fire evacuation routes, coordinating facility and custodial needs for scheduled events, maintaining timelines for school opening, and overseeing the daily opening and closing of facilities. The role determines equipment obsolescence, sets maintenance priorities, develops preventive maintenance programs and emergency repair systems, and devises strategies to reduce vandalism, theft, and arson, while safeguarding school property and maintaining security procedures. The Facilities Manager also inspects buildings and grounds, conducts fire and tornado drills, manages the raising and lowering of the national flag, supervises custodial services, and collaborates with local police on security matters. Finally, the role assists in coordinating transportation, custodial, cafeteria, and other support services.
